How much do distribution center general man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average yearly pay for distribution center general manager in Boca Raton, FL is $70,593.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$56,900.00 and $79,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a distribution center general manager?

To thrive as a Distribution Center General Manager, you need strong leadership abilities, logistics and supply chain knowledge, and experience in warehouse operations, typically supported by a bachelor's degree in business, logistics, or a related field. Familiarity with warehouse management systems (WMS), inventory control software, and lean management certifications is highly valuable. Excellent problem-solving, communication, and team-building skills help you motivate staff and coordinate complex operations. These skills are vital to ensure efficient, cost-effective distribution center performance and to meet organizational goals in a dynamic environment.

What are some common challenges faced by distribution center general managers, and how can they address them?

Distribution Center General Managers often face challenges such as maintaining operational efficiency, adapting to fluctuating order volumes, and managing a diverse workforce. Coordinating logistics to ensure timely shipments while minimizing costs can be demanding, especially during peak seasons. Successful managers address these challenges by fostering strong communication across teams, leveraging technology for inventory and workflow management, and continuously developing their staff through training and clear performance metrics. Building a culture of safety and continuous improvement also helps in overcoming daily operational hurdles.

The Distribution Center General Manager oversees the entire distribution center, focusing on strategic planning, operations, and staff management. The Warehouse Supervisor handles daily warehouse activities, supervising staff and ensuring smooth operations. While both roles are vital in logistics, the General Manager has broader responsibilities and higher-level decision-making authority.

What does a distribution center general manager do?

A Distribution Center General Manager oversees the daily operations of a distribution center, ensuring efficient receipt, storage, and dispatch of goods. They are responsible for managing staff, optimizing processes, and maintaining safety and compliance standards. Their role also includes budgeting, inventory control, and coordinating with other departments to meet company goals. Effective leadership and strong organizational skills are crucial for success in this position.
